Abstract

Handling anxiety in pregnant women during the birthing process can use pharmacological and non-pharmacological methods, one of which is the hypnobirthing method. Hypnobirthing during pregnancy and childbirth is a combination of the natural birth process with hypnosis therapy to build self-confidence, positive perception, reduce fear, anxiety and tension before childbirth, during labor and after childbirth. This study aims to determine the application of relaxation techniques and hypnobirthing methods to reduce anxiety levels during childbirth at the Novi Lintas Timur Midwife Clinic, Panyabungan District.Mandailing Natal Regency in 2024..The type of research used is descriptive research with a Pre-Experimental One-Group Pretest – Posttest Design approach. The population in the study were mothers who gave birth at the Novi midwife clinic. The sampling technique used Accidental Sampling with a sample size of 10 people. Data collection using primary and secondary data. Data analysis used the simultaneous F test with a significance level of F > 0.05). The results of the analysis show that there is an influence of the hypnobirthing method to reduce anxiety during childbirth with a value of P = 0.001 where P = <0.05. It is hoped that this research can provide information and input for health workers in order to develop the quality of services at the Novi Lintas Timur Midwife Clinic, Panyabungan District, Mandailing Natal Regency.

Abstract

The purpose of this study was to determine the effect of hypnobirthing relaxation on the anxiety level of primigravida mothers in the third trimester in facing labor preparation. The method used was quasi-experimental research involving 20 primigravida mothers selected through random sampling technique. The intervention was carried out by providing hypnobirthing sessions, and anxiety levels were measured using the Hamilton Rating Scale for Anxiety (HRS-A) before and after the intervention. The main results showed that there was a significant effect of hypnobirthing relaxation on reducing anxiety levels, with a p value = 0.001, which indicates that this intervention is effective in reducing anxiety in pregnant women. The practical implication of this study is that hypnobirthing can be used as a useful method to help primigravida mothers overcome anxiety before childbirth, so it is recommended for health workers to integrate this technique in childbirth preparation programs.

Abstract

lacental retention is the cause of most cases of postpartum hemorrhage while postpartum hemorrhage is the cause of the most maternal deaths in Indonesia. This study aims to determine the age and parity with the incidence of placental retention in pregnant women at Dumai City Hospital, Dumai District, Dumai City in 2023. This research is a descriptive research with a survey method. The population is 35 people. The sampling technique uses the total sampling technique, where all populations are sampled as many as 35 postpartum mothers. Data collection uses primary data using questionnaires. The data was processed, presented by Frequency and Cross Tabulation and then analyzed by Chi-square Test. The results of the study showed that the majority of mothers were 20-35 years old as many as 21 people (60.0%) and the majority parity of Scundipara was 15 people (42.9%). The incidence of placental retention in pregnant women at Dumai City Hospital, Dumai District, Dumai City in 2023 is as many as 14 people (40.0%). The results of data analysis for age with the chi square test obtained p value = 0.007 (p<0.05) which showed that there was a relationship between age and the incidence of placental retention in pregnant women. The results of data analysis for parity with the chi square test obtained p value = 0.001 (p<0.05) which means that there is a relationship between parity and the incidence of placental retention in pregnant women. The conclusion of this study is that there is a relationship between age and parity with the incidence of placental retention in pregnant women at Dumai City Hospital, Dumai District, Dumai City in 2023. :P health workers, especially midwives, should be able to handle placental retention quickly and appropriately so that the incidence of primary postpartum hemorrhage and maternal mortality can be minimized.

Abstract

This study aims to evaluate the effectiveness of watermelon consumption in reducing hypertension in pregnant women at Nurlina Independent Practice Midwife, Kampung Baru, Bukit Kapur, Dumai City. Hypertension in pregnant women is a significant health problem, which can have a negative impact on maternal and fetal health. The research design used was pre-experimental with a one-group pre-post test approach, involving 20 pregnant women respondents who experienced hypertension. Data were collected through blood pressure measurements before and after the intervention of watermelon consumption for 7 days, with data analysis using paired t-test statistical test to determine significant differences between pre-test and post-test values. The results showed that there was a significant reduction in blood pressure after watermelon consumption, with mean systolic blood pressure reduced from 140 mmHg to 120 mmHg (p < 0.05). These findings suggest that watermelon may be an effective dietary intervention for managing hypertension in pregnant women. The implications of the results of this study suggest that watermelon consumption can be considered as part of a strategy to prevent and manage hypertension in maternal health practice, and can be a recommendation for health policy to increase awareness of the importance of a healthy diet during pregnancy.

Abstract

Simalingkar Health Center is one of the facilities closest to the community, which is equipped with professional health workers. This study aims to determine the factors of service quality according to community perceptions that influence the utilization of basic health services at Simalingkar Health Center. The study was conducted in March - May 2025. This study is an explanatory research type with a cross-sectional approach while the population is the entire population in the Simalingkar Health Center work area with a sample of 72 people taken by random sampling. From the results of univariant & bivariate analysis using linear regression tests that there is a significant effect of service comfort on the utilization of basic health services p (0.000), there is an effect of service information on the utilization of basic health services p (0.009), while service continuity p (0.394), service efficiency p (0.391), and security p (0.480) and human rights in service p (0.685) do not affect the utilization of basic health services at Simalingkar Health Center. The seven dimensions assessed in this study were stated as moderate (continuity, efficiency, security, human rights, comfort, access and information). There is a need to improve the quality of service, especially in the areas of service comfort, service information, service access, without ignoring the other 4 dimensions (continuity, efficiency, security, human rights) in health services in order to realize quality health services as expected to create a prosperous society.

Abstract

In 2022, WHO (World Hearth Organization) found that infant mortality rate was 560,000 caused by umbilical cord infection. In Southeast Asian countries, it is estimated that there are 220,000 infant deaths caused by unclean umbilical cord care. Umbilical cord care is to treat and tie the umbilical cord which causes physical separation of mother and baby. Then, the umbilical cord is treated in a clean condition and free from umbilical cord infection. Good and correct umbilical cord care will have a positive impact, namely the umbilical cord will "fall off" on the 5th to 7th day without any complications, while the negative impact of improper umbilical cord care is that the baby will experience neonatal tetanus and can result in death. The study was conducted in February – April 2025. This study is an Analytical Correlation study, namely to determine the mother's knowledge about umbilical cord care in babies aged 0-14 days. The population in this study were all postpartum mothers who had babies aged 0-14 days at the Delima clinic with 30 respondents. From the results of the study conducted, it can be concluded that from 30 respondents who had good knowledge, there were 6 respondents (20%), who had sufficient knowledge, 11 respondents (36.67%) and who had poor knowledge, 13 respondents (43.33%). It is expected that health workers, especially midwives, will provide counseling on umbilical cord care for babies aged 0-14 days.
